I was in the Heritage App last night and was looking around at various sales of Cracker Jack Jackson within the 2 range and saw a PSA 2 sold in May for $63k, but what was more interesting I saw a pending offer on a SGC 2.5 (from 1/6) at $63k. Does Heritage note offers while owners are thinking or is it really Pending and the payment brokering etc is happening?

I have always wondered what would happen to his card values if the shoeless one by some kind of miracle, which would send Judge Landis spinning in his grave (good place for him), got into the Hall of Fame.
I can see 2 scenarios playing out; first, many may gravitate even more intensely for Joe's cards now that justice (I guess) has been done and he has deservedly secured an enshrinement. Those in the hunt are now willing to pay more for his scant cards, or many may lose some interest now that the legend and mystique about Joe is gone, his role or not in the '19 WS fix really no longer matters and lose some interest in trying to secure any of his cards.
